Nursing Home Activity Coordinator

Cpl Healthcare in partnership with our client based in Roscommon are currently recruiting a dedicated and creative Nursing Home Activity Coordinator to provide residents with engaging and recreational activities, they play a crucial role in the well-being and quality of life of nursing home residents.

The ideal candidate is someone with a passion for working with the elderly, has excellent interpersonal skills, and a creative mindset for planning diverse activities.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Planning and Organizing Activities: Design a variety of activities that cater to the interests and abilities of the residents, including arts and crafts, music sessions, exercise classes, gardening, and social events
  • Personalized Engagement: Engage with residents to understand their preferences and past hobbies, tailoring activities to meet their individual needs
  • Promoting Social Interaction: Create opportunities for residents to socialize and build relationships, helping to combat feelings of isolation and loneliness
  • Health and Wellbeing: Organize activities that promote physical, mental, and emotional wellbeing, such as gentle exercise, memory games, and relaxation sessions
  • Logistics and Coordination: Manage the logistics of activities, including arranging transportation for outings, booking venues, and ensuring all necessary materials and equipment are available
  • Volunteer and Staff Coordination: Train and supervise volunteers or staff members who assist with activities
  • Feedback and Improvement: Collect feedback from residents to assess the effectiveness of activities and make improvements as needed
